Output dd509f41e5c7a8978ead53ee88c439756c7633d058b74c4b07ba9f1eac763066:1

value
1843340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99a3d02661036c2aec32dce93d7be1afc05ddb5 OP_EQUAL
address
3MXbKqWSdcANdLCkqDAevMJX8Y4DYmiJZY
transaction
dd509f41e5c7a8978ead53ee88c439756c7633d058b74c4b07ba9f1eac763066
spent
true